Quality of Espresso

The quality of espresso is a game-changer for any family coffee lover. When choosing an espresso machine, I always look for a model with a 20-bar pressure system. This ideal pressure extracts rich flavors and creates that delightful crema. Temperature control is also crucial; I aim for machines that brew around 198°F to maximize coffee oils and flavors.

A pre-infusion function is another feature I appreciate, as it gradually builds pressure, enhancing the aroma and depth of the espresso. Plus, I make sure to use a conical burr grinder for uniform particle size, which greatly improves extraction. Finally, consistent tamping pressure is important; it guarantees even water flow and avoids bitter or watery shots.

Maintenance and Cleaning

While enjoying high-quality espresso is important, maintaining your machine is just as crucial for a family that loves coffee. Regular cleaning helps keep your espresso machine performing at its best and extends its lifespan. I find that daily tasks, like wiping the steam wand and cleaning the drip tray, are quick and easy. For a deeper clean, I tackle the portafilter and brewing parts weekly to prevent any buildup. Some machines even offer self-cleaning features, which are a game changer! Always follow the manufacturer’s guidelines for cleaning frequency—neglecting this can lead to poor espresso quality and costly repairs. A clean machine not only enhances the flavor but also guarantees our family can enjoy great coffee for years to come.

Price and Value

When choosing an espresso machine for my family, evaluating price and value is essential. Espresso machines can range from budget-friendly options under $100 to high-end models exceeding $1,000, so I need to determine what features are worth the investment. I’ve found that a machine with a 20-bar pressure system often delivers professional-quality extraction, which is vital for me. It’s also important to factor in ongoing costs like maintenance, cleaning supplies, and necessary accessories, as these can add up quickly. Customer ratings above 4.0 out of 5 stars help me gauge performance relative to price. Finally, I always check for warranties, as reputable brands often provide one-year protections against defects, enhancing the machine’s overall value.

How Do I Clean and Maintain an Espresso Machine?

Cleaning and maintaining my espresso machine is essential for great coffee. I start by emptying the used grounds and rinsing the portafilter. I run hot water through the machine to flush out any residue. I also wipe down the steam wand to prevent milk buildup. Once a month, I descal the machine with a vinegar solution. Regular maintenance keeps my espresso tasting fresh and guarantees my machine lasts longer. Trust me, it’s worth it!

What Types of Coffee Beans Are Best for Espresso?

When I think of coffee beans, I see two worlds: light roasts and dark roasts. For espresso, I’ve found that medium to dark roasts really shine. They provide that rich, bold flavor and a nice crema. I love blends that combine Arabica for sweetness and Robusta for strength. Ultimately, it’s about personal taste, so I suggest experimenting with different beans to find what excites your palate the most. Trust me, it’s worth it!
